OA Publishing Agreements

The Library actively pursues OA publishing agreements (also known as transformative agreements) with publishers that both:

  • Cover article processing charges (APCs) for HKBU authors

  • Maintain or even enhance existing journal subscriptions

Note:
  1. Publishers treat HKBU and BNBU as separate entities under OA agreements. Only HKBU staff and students can enjoy the deals.
  2. Always use your HKBU email to submit manuscripts to access APC waivers!
  3. Choose a CC BY license for greatest visibility and reuse of your work. If you are concerned about commercial reuse, choose CC BY-NC-ND
  4. Not every journal from each publisher may be eligible. Please check and confirm that the journal you want to publish in is eligible before submitting your manuscript.

It indicates the remaining quota for OA requests by the end of 2025.
Note that even if a quota is available, it may be exhausted by other concurrent article submissions before your OA request is processed.
